Affordable Quotes for Brick and Metal Fence Installation and Design Options



Understanding Brick and Metal Fence Quotes


When it comes to home improvement projects, adding a fence can significantly enhance your property’s aesthetics, security, and privacy. Among the various types of fencing available, brick and metal fences stand out due to their durability and elegant appearance. However, understanding the costs associated with these materials is crucial for homeowners considering this investment. In this article, we will explore the factors that influence brick and metal fence quotes and provide tips for getting the best deal.


Brick Fences Timeless Elegance and Strength


Brick fences are celebrated for their solid construction and classic charm. They can complement various architectural styles, adding value to your property. The cost of a brick fence can vary depending on several factors


1. Materials The type of brick you choose can significantly affect the price. Standard bricks are typically less expensive, while specialty bricks may raise costs. Additionally, mortar and other construction materials will be included in the overall quote.


2. Labor Brick fencing requires skilled labor for installation. The complexity of the design, accessibility of the site, and the experience of the workers can all influence labor costs. It’s essential to get quotes from multiple contractors to ensure you find a fair price.


3. Design and Size A more intricate design or a larger fence will naturally cost more. Custom features like pillars or decorative toppings will also add to the total expenses.


4. Location Geographic location can impact pricing. Areas with high demand for construction services may see higher labor costs, while regions with abundant brick supply may lower material costs.


Metal Fences Modern Versatility and Security


Metal fences, such as those made from wrought iron or aluminum, provide a contemporary aesthetic with added security benefits. They can be more affordable than brick, but costs still vary based on similar factors

1. Material Type Aluminum tends to be lighter and less expensive than wrought iron, which, while durable, can also be costlier. The quality of metals and the finishing options available (like powder coating) will also play a role in the overall price.


2. Height and Design The height of a metal fence and its design complexity will directly impact costs. A taller, more ornate design will typically require more materials and time to install.


3. Installation Costs While metal fencing can be easier and quicker to install than brick, labor costs can still vary. Hiring a skilled contractor who knows how to work with metal is crucial for ensuring a quality installation.


4. Local Regulations Some local governments have regulations concerning fence height and materials, which can influence your design choice and, consequently, the cost.


Tips for Obtaining Accurate Quotes


- Get Multiple Quotes Contact several contractors to compare costs. Ensure you provide them with the same specifications to get accurate comparisons.


- Discuss Your Needs Be clear about the style and purpose of your fence. Whether you prioritize security, privacy, or aesthetics, communicate this with the contractors.


- Check References and Reviews Look for contractors with positive reviews and a history of quality work. This is especially important if you're investing in higher-end materials like brick and wrought iron.


- Understand the Quote Ensure you understand what the quote includes—materials, labor, installation time, and any additional fees.


In conclusion, understanding the factors that influence brick and metal fence quotes can help you make a more informed decision. By considering materials, design, labor, and location, you can select the perfect fence that meets your needs and fits within your budget. Investing in quality fencing not only enhances your property’s value but also provides lasting durability and safety for years to come.
